Electrician Diploma, Certificate and Degree Programs near Delmar NY<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"DelmarThere are multiple ways to receive electrician training in a technical or vocational school<\/a> near Delmar NY. You may choose a certificate or diploma program, or obtain an Associate Degree. Bachelor’s Degrees are available at certain schools, but are not as prevalent as the other three options. In many cases these programs are offered together with an apprenticeship program, which are required by most states to be licensed or if you intend to earn certification.
